European airplane manufacturer Airbus has announced a healthy order book at the end of this year's Farnborough Air Show.
Airbus chief, Thomas Enders, said that the company had secured 247 firm orders and nine commitments to purchase worth more than 25 billion euros. This Airbus's second best ever sales record at the air show. In spite of this, Enders cautioned that business will be down compared to 2007 due to possible order cancellations by airlines struggling with soaring fuel prices.
